  • 9 solitudo

    sōlĭtūdo, ĭnis, f. [solus], a being alone or solitary, loneliness, solitariness, solitude (of a person or place); a lonely place, desert, wilderness (class. in sing. and plur.; cf.: secretum, secessus).
    I.
    In gen.:

    ampla domus dedecori saepe domino fit, si est in eā solitudo,

    Cic. Off. 1, 39, 139:

    si aliquis nos deus ex hac hominum frequentiā tolleret et in solitudine uspiam collocaret,

    id. Lael. 23, 87; so (opp. frequentia) id. Pis. 22, 53;

    opp. celebritas,

    id. Inv. 1, 26, 38; Plin. Pan. 49, 2:

    audistis, quae solitudo in agris esset, quae vastitas, quae fuga aratorum, quam deserta, quam relicta omnia,

    Cic. Verr. 2, 4, 51, § 114; cf.:

    quācumque venis, fuga est et ingens Circa te solitudo,

    Mart. 3, 44, 3:

    solitudo ante ostium,

    Ter. And. 2, 2, 25:

    ubi postquam solitudinem intellexit,

    Sall. J. 93, 3:

    erat ab oratoribus quaedam in foro solitudo,

    Cic. Brut. 63, 227:

    neque vero hic non contemptus est a tyrannis atque ejus solitudo,

    Nep. Thras. 2, 2:

    mihi solitudo et recessus provincia est,

    Cic. Att. 12, 26, 2:

    in aliquā desertissimā solitudine,

    id. Verr. 2, 5, 67, § 171:

    Sigambri se in solitudinem ac silvas abdiderant,

    Caes. B. G. 4, 18 fin.: an malitis hanc solitudinem vestram quam urbem hostium esse? solitary, desert place (Rome), Liv. 5, 53, 7:

    delere omne Latium, vastas inde solitudines facere,

    id. 8, 13, 15; cf. id. 39, 18:

    nec umquam ex solitudine suā prodeuntem, nisi ut solitudinem faceret,

    Plin. Pan. 48 fin.:

    ubi solitudinem faciunt, pacem appellant,

    Tac. Agr. 30 fin.; Curt. 8, 8, 10; 9, 2, 24; Liv. 39, 18, 2:

    nivosae solitudini cohaerentes,

    bordering on, Amm. 23, 6, 64.— With gen.:

    in hac omnis humani cultūs solitudine,

    Curt. 7, 3, 12.— Plur., Cic. Rep. 6, 19, 20; id. Fam. 2, 16, 6; Caes. B. G. 6, 23:

    solitudines renuntiavere missi milites ad explorandum,

    Plin. 6, 29, 35, § 181; Vell. 2, 55, 4; Plin. 6, 13, 14, § 33; 6, 17, 20, § 53.—
    II.
    In partic., analog. to the Gr. erêmia, in respect of something wanting, a being left alone or deserted, a state of want, destitution, deprivation:

    per hujus (orbae) solitudinem Te obtestor,

    Ter. And. 1, 5, 55; cf.:

    liberorum solitudo,

    Cic. Verr. 2, 1, 58, § 153:

    liberorum ac parentum solitudo,

    Quint. 6, 1, 18:

    Caesenniae viduitas ac solitudo,

    Cic. Caecin. 5, 13; id. Q. Fr. 1, 4, 5:

    solitudo atque inopia,

    id. Quint. 1, 5; cf. id. Q. Fr. 1, 1, 8, § 25:

    Messalina tribus omnino comitantibus (id repente solitudinis erat) spatium urbis pedibus emensa,

    Tac. A. 11, 32:

    magistratuum,

    Liv. 6, 35 fin.

  • 14 उपनिषद् _upaniṣad

    उपनिषद् f. [said to be from उपनि-सद् 'knowledge derived from sitting at the feet of the preceptor'; but, according to Indian authorities, it means 'to destroy ignorance by revealing the knowledge of the Supreme Spirit and cutting off the bonds of worldly existence'; यथा य इमां ब्रह्मविद्यामुपयन्त्यात्मभावेन श्रद्धाभक्तिपुरःसराः सन्तस्तेषां गर्भजन्मजरारोगाद्यनर्थपूगं निशातयति परं वा ब्रह्म गमयति अविद्यादि- संसारकारणं चात्यन्तमवसादयति विनाशयतीत्युपनिषद् । उपनिपूर्वस्य सदेरेवमर्थस्मरणात्; Śaṅkara]
    1 N. of certain mystical writings attached to the Brāhmaṇas, the chief aim of which is to ascertain the secret meaning of the Vedas; Bv.2.4; Māl 1.7; (other etymologies also are given to explain the name:- (1) उपनीय तमात्मानं ब्रह्मापास्तद्वयं यतः । निहन्त्यविद्यां तज्जं च तस्मादुपनिषद्भवेत् ॥ or (2) निहत्यानर्थमूलं स्वाविद्यां प्रत्यक्तया परम् । नयत्यपास्तसंभेदमतो वोपनिषद्भवेत् ॥ or (3) प्रवृत्तिहेतून्निःशेषास्तन्मूलोच्छेदकत्वतः । यतोवसादयेद्विद्या तस्मा- दुपनिषद्भवेत् ॥ In the मुक्तकोपनिषद् 18 Upaniṣads are mentioned, but some more have been added to this number. They are said to have been the source of the six Darśanas or systems of philosophy, particularly of the Vedānta Philosophy. The more important Upani- ṣads are:- ईशकेनकठप्रश्नमुण्डमाण्डूक्यतित्तिरः । ऐतरेयं च छान्दोग्यं बृहदारण्यकं तथा ॥.
    -2 (a) An esoteric or secret doctrine, mystical meaning, words of mystery; साङ्गोपाङ्गोपनिषदः सरहस्यः प्रदीयताम् Rām.1.55.16. (b) Mystical know- ledge or instruction; मन्त्रपारायण˚ U.6; दिव्यामस्त्रोपनिषदमृषेर्यः कृशाश्वस्य शिष्यात् Mv.2.2.
    -3 True knowledge regarding the Supreme Spirit.
    -4 Sacred or religious lore.
    -5 Secrecy, seclusion.
    -6 A neighbouring mansion.
    -7 A lonely place.
    -8 A religious observance.
    -9 Me- ditation, यदेव विद्यया करोति श्रद्धयोपनिषदा तदेव वीर्यवत्तरं भवति Ch. Up.1.1.1.
    -1 One that takes to (like a boat); तस्योपनिषत्सत्यस्य सत्यमिति Bṛi. Up.2.1.2.
